Installation methods

How Vinyl Flooring is installed — and why it affects price

Floating (click-lock)

Planks snap together over underlayment — no adhesive. Fastest install, lowest labor cost.

Glue-down

Full-spread adhesive to subfloor. Required in some commercial applications or over radiant heat.

Loose lay

Friction-fit — no click, no adhesive. Fast tearout if needed. Limited to specific heavy-backed products.

Local factors

Why Riverview changes a vinyl flooring installation

Hillsborough County residents must place flooring like tile, hardwood, carpet, and vinyl in containers or bundles not exceeding 50 pounds for standard curbside collection. Large quantities of construction debris require transport to the county solid waste facility for disposal at the established per-ton tipping fee.
Standard flooring replacement in Riverview, FL usually does not require a permit, but permits can come into play when the project includes structural, electrical, or plumbing work.
A flooring contractor is not required to obtain a city contractor registration in Riverview, Florida, as it is an unincorporated community. The department is not specified.
Riverview has humid months that reach about 83% humidity, summer highs average about 89F, there are about 55.8 days above 90F each year, so spring and fall are usually the easiest seasons for flooring installation while hotter summer periods need more attention to acclimation, storage, and jobsite conditions.
Plank quality, wear layer, and locking system change both material cost and installation pace.
Median home age in this market is about 19 years, so subfloor prep and transitions often matter more than expected.
Local installer notes — Riverview

Homes in the Summerfield area, largely built in the early 2000s, typically feature concrete slab foundations requiring careful moisture mitigation before flooring installation. With 56 days above 90°F annually, flooring adhesives must be rated for high heat to prevent delamination.

Is LVP actually waterproof?

The plank itself is 100% waterproof — water cannot damage the core or wear layer. However, standing water that sits in seams can eventually reach the subfloor, which is typically not waterproof. 'Waterproof floor' means the product, not the installation.
